📚 Topic Summary

Minimum wage is the lowest hourly wage an employer can legally pay its employees. It's designed to protect workers, but its economic effects are debated. Increasing the minimum wage can lead to higher earnings for low-wage workers, potentially reducing poverty and stimulating demand. However, it may also increase labor costs for businesses, possibly leading to job losses or higher prices for consumers. The actual impact depends on factors like the size of the increase, the health of the economy, and the industry.

Understanding the minimum wage helps us analyze how government policies affect employment, income distribution, and overall economic welfare. Let's test your understanding with the following activities!

🧠 Part A: Vocabulary

Match the term with its correct definition:

Term Definition
1. Minimum Wage A. A sustained increase in the general price level of goods and services in an economy.
2. Labor Demand B. The quantity of labor employers are willing and able to hire at a given wage rate.
3. Labor Supply C. The lowest hourly wage an employer can legally pay its employees.
4. Inflation D. A situation in which individuals are actively seeking employment but are unable to find a job.
5. Unemployment E. The quantity of labor workers are willing and able to offer at a given wage rate.
